body {
	margin:0px 0px 0px 0px;
	font-size:12px;
	font-family:NanumGothicWeb;
	color:#666666;
	background:#ffffff;
	line-height:17px;
}

td {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	FONT-FAMILY: NanumGothicWeb;
	font-size:12px;
	color:#666666;
	line-height:17px;
} 

p{margin:0;
  padding:0;
  }


A {
	CURSOR: hand
}

A.int:visited {
	FONT-SIZE: 12px; COLOR: #666666; FONT-FAMILY: NanumGothicWeb; TEXT-DECORATION: none
}
A.int:link {
	FONT-SIZE: 12px; COLOR: #6e4987; FONT-FAMILY: NanumGothicWeb; TEXT-DECORATION: none
}
A.int:hover {
	FONT-SIZE: 12px; COLOR: #6e4987; FONT-FAMILY: NanumGothicWeb; TEXT-DECORATION: underline
}


.back1{
	background: url(../img/menu_back3.gif) repeat-x right;
}


.back2{
	background: url(../img/find_background3.gif) repeat-y bottom;
}


.copyright_back {

	BACKGROUND-COLOR: #f3f3f3;
	height:85px;
	font-size:11px;
	font-family:NanumGothicWeb, "돋움";
	color:#97908e;
}


.hn01{
	font-family: NanumGothicWeb, "돋움"; 
	font-size: 12px; 
	color: #5B5B5B; 
	text-decoration: none;
}


.data { font-family: NanumGothicWeb, "돋움"; font-size: 11px; color: #976400; text-decoration: none}

.data1 { font-family: NanumGothicWeb, "돋움"; font-size: 12px; color: #5eaedc; font-weight: bold; text-decoration: none}


.hn_sub {
	font-family: NanumGothicWeb, "돋움";
	font-size: 12px;
	color: #890909;
	text-decoration: none;
	font-weight: normal;
}

.hn_sub2 {
	font-family: NanumGothicWeb, "돋움";
	font-size: 12px;
	color: #894ae0;
	text-decoration: none;
	font-weight: normal;
	font-weight: bold;
}

.hn_holes {
}

.notice1 {
     font-family: NanumGothicWeb, "돋움";
	font-size: 11px;
	color: #5B5B5B;
}

.copyright_k {
	FONT-SIZE: 11px; COLOR: #818181; LINE-HEIGHT: 18px; FONT-FAMILY: NanumGothicWeb
}

.table-wapper { position: relative; width: 300px; padding: 40px 0 20px; background: #eee; }
.table-container { width: 300px; height: 200px; overflow: auto; }
table.table-content caption { position: absolute; top: 0; left: 0; width: 274px; height: 20px; text-align: center; background: yellow; }
table.table-content thead tr { position: absolute; top: 20px; left: 0; height: 20px; }
table.table-content th,
table.table-content td	{ width: 90px; padding: 0; background: #fff; }
table.table-content tfoot td { position: absolute; bottom: 0; left: 0; width: 276px; text-align: center; background: yellow; }